Embark on an unforgettable guided tour from Kotor, Montenegro, where you’ll journey along the legendary serpentine road, famed for its 25 switchbacks and captivating views over the Bay of Kotor. As you ascend this historic route, you’ll uncover stories of romance and engineering, all while basking in panoramic vistas unique to this region.
Your adventure continues in the village of Njeguši, nestled between Kotor and Lovćen National Park. Here, immerse yourself in Montenegrin culture by sampling and purchasing local delicacies such as prosciutto, cheese, and wine. Discover the village’s noble heritage, shaped by generations of rulers and local clans, as you stroll through its charming streets.
Next, ascend to the Mausoleum of Petar II Petrović-Njegoš, a revered Montenegrin prince-bishop, philosopher, and poet. Climb 441 steps to reach the awe-inspiring hexagonal chapel, where a monumental granite statue and a dazzling gold mosaic ceiling await. From here, marvel at sweeping views that reveal nearly 70% of Montenegro’s dramatic landscapes.
After soaking in rich history and culture, embrace the serenity of Montenegro’s pristine nature at the summit. Relax with a coffee, breathe in the fresh mountain air, or simply enjoy the stunning outlook over the Bay of Kotor and surrounding towns, including Tivat, Perast, and Herceg Novi.
End your day with a thrilling cable car descent from 1,350 meters down to 65 meters above sea level. In just eleven minutes, glide above the breathtaking bay, capturing unforgettable memories of Kotor and its picturesque surroundings.
